Flat roof waterproofing services involve applying specialized coatings or membranes to the surface of flat roofs to prevent water infiltration. This process typically includes inspecting the existing roof for damage, cleaning the surface, and then applying waterproof materials designed to create a durable barrier against moisture. The goal is to protect the underlying structure from water damage, which can lead to leaks, mold growth, and structural deterioration over time. Professionals use a variety of waterproofing solutions tailored to the specific needs of each roof, ensuring a long-lasting seal that withstands weather exposure.

These services address common problems associated with flat roofs, such as ponding water, leaks, and surface degradation. Flat roofs are particularly susceptible to water pooling due to their horizontal design, which can increase the risk of leaks if the waterproofing layer fails or becomes compromised. Over time, exposure to sunlight, temperature fluctuations, and debris can cause the roofing materials to deteriorate, making waterproofing an essential maintenance step. Proper waterproofing helps extend the lifespan of the roof and reduces the likelihood of costly repairs caused by water intrusion.

Properties that typically utilize flat roof waterproofing include commercial buildings, industrial facilities, apartment complexes, and some residential structures with flat or low-slope roofs. These properties often have large, expansive roof surfaces that require effective waterproofing to prevent water damage and maintain structural integrity. Flat roofs are favored in urban settings for their space efficiency and accessibility, making waterproofing an important service to ensure their durability and functionality over time.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for flat roof waterproofing typically ranges from $1 to $4 per square foot, depending on the type of membrane used, such as EPDM or TPO. For a standard 1,000-square-foot roof, material expenses may vary between $1,000 and $4,000.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for waterproofing a flat roof gener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. For a typical residential project, this can amount to approximately $2,000 to $5,000, depending on complexity and local rates.

Project Size & Complexity - Larger or more complex flat roof waterproofing projects tend to increase overall costs, with larger roofs potentially reaching $10,000 or more. Factors like roof accessibility and existing damage can influence pricing estimates.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as surface preparation, insulation, or repairs can add to the total, often ranging from a few hundred to several thousand dollars. Contact local pros to get tailored estimates for spec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common methods for waterproofing flat roofs? Local service providers may use techniques such as membrane application, liquid coatings, or built-up roofing systems to waterproof flat roofs effectively.

How long does flat roof waterproofing typically last? The lifespan of waterproofing solutions varies depending on materials and installation quality, but many treatments can last between 5 to 15 years with proper maintenance.

Are there signs that a flat roof needs waterproofing? Indicators include persistent leaks, ponding water, visible cracks, or blistering surfaces, prompting consultation with local waterproofing specialists.

Can waterproofing be applied to an existing flat roof? Yes, many waterproofing options can be applied over existing roofing materials, but a professional assessment is recommended to determine suitability.

What factors influence the choice of waterproofing method? Factors include roof age, material, exposure conditions, and budget, which local contractors can evaluate to recommend appropriate solutions.
